Inka has Cerebral Hypoplasia. There is NO coordination between her front and hind legs. They all follow their own way !So ske keeps falling every 4 steps; and when she tries to run , she looks like a circus-artist, making one salto after the other. Looks so funny sometimes. We always say then that Inka had to much whiskey again ! She is also shaking her head (like an (Alzheimer), and her lower jaw opens and closes sometimes without any reason. Oh yes, she also cannot guess a distance; so when she tries to jump up a chair, she jumps either to high or to law... .We all fear she won't live very long.
